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/sql/73.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 拖放不使用外部监视器_C#_Sql_Visual Studio_Winforms - Fatal编程技术网

C# 拖放不使用外部监视器

C# 拖放不使用外部监视器,c#,sql,visual-studio,winforms,C#,Sql,Visual Studio,Winforms,我正在为我的学习做一个小项目。这是我在VisualStudio2019社区版中第一次接触SQL 我的研究文档说,我可以将表从“数据源”窗口拖到表单上,然后会出现DataGridView。那不行。因此,我将表的属性从DataGridView更改为Details 根据我所在大学的文档,它现在应该为表中的每一行添加一个带有标签的文本框 你猜怎么着?那也不行。光标变为“Drop here”符号,但如果我将元素放到表单上,则不会发生任何事情 没有错误消息或类似的东西 看起来很适合我。这是我电脑上的数据库文

我正在为我的学习做一个小项目。这是我在VisualStudio2019社区版中第一次接触SQL

我的研究文档说,我可以将表从“数据源”窗口拖到表单上,然后会出现DataGridView。那不行。因此,我将表的属性从DataGridView更改为Details

根据我所在大学的文档,它现在应该为表中的每一行添加一个带有标签的文本框

你猜怎么着?那也不行。光标变为“Drop here”符号,但如果我将元素放到表单上,则不会发生任何事情

没有错误消息或类似的东西

看起来很适合我。这是我电脑上的数据库文件,所以不会有连接问题

谷歌和谷歌没有帮我


也许其他人可以?:)

哦,天哪。。。这是我的外部监视器的问题

如果我将表格放到窗体上,而Visual Studio显示在我的外部监视器(分辨率1920*1080)上,它将无法工作

如果我把它放到表单上,而Visual Studio ist显示在我的Surface Book 2(分辨率3000*2000)的内置屏幕上,它就像一个符咒


怎么会有人知道这件事?无论如何,感谢您阅读问题…

添加到您的答案中…
我不能在我的机器上测试这个…但我认为值得一试

转到工具->选项环境->预览功能。
检查 优化具有不同像素密度的屏幕的渲染 (需要重新启动)

在VS2019中…
转到工具->选项->环境->常规
检查 优化具有不同像素密度的屏幕的渲染 (需要重新启动)


另外…请确保您使用的是最新版本…某些预览版本出现问题。

使用Visual Studio和Windows窗体应用程序对我来说并不陌生。它是Windows窗体应用程序和数据库的组合。听起来不错,但无论是选中还是未选中都没有任何区别。我找到了@Options->Environment->General。我使用的是16.4版。3@Shendayan哦,这是值得一试的…我将在几分钟内删除这个答案…如果你不介意,就放在那里吧。也许这对其他人有帮助:)你如何确定这是监视器问题?我有两个显示器,一个全高清,它可以工作另一个4k,我在4k显示器上正好有这个问题。我使用的骑手并排和骑手上它的作品很好,在两个显示器